Only in Australia do random koalas borrow your fishing rod!
The Murray River is known for its great fishing and also its koala population that inhabit the large gum trees that grow along the banks. It's not uncommon to encounter koalas while fishing from the banks of the Murray, this family however had a once in a lifetime opportunity to actually fish with a koala. After wandering around their campsite for a few minutes, the cheeky marsupial then decided it would like to try his hand at this fishing thing. The clever koala must have been watching a few fisherman as, apart from mastering the reel, showed some pretty good instinct with fishing rod in hand.
